Abstract
Palladium complexes immobilized onto generations 0-3 PAMAM dendrimers supported on silica, in the presence of 1,4-bis(diphenylphosphino)butane, were used as catalysts for the cyclocarbonylation of 2-allylphenols, 2-allylaniline, 2-vinylphenol and 2-vinylaniline affording five-, six- or seven membered ring lactones and lactams. Good conversions were realized using the catalytic system, and the catalyst was recycled 3-5 times. The influence of the spacer chain was investigated, as well as the solvent and the CO/H2 ratio, on the selectivity and the recyclability of the cyclocarbonylation reactions.
